Incorrect Training Techniques



Improper training techniques can substantially contribute to back pain and injuries. When you raise heavy objects, remember to flex your knees and utilize your legs to lift, as opposed to relying upon your back muscles. Stay clear of twisting your body while training and keep the things close to your body to decrease pressure on your back. It's crucial to keep a straight back and stay clear of rounding your shoulders while raising to prevent unneeded stress on your spine.

Always analyze the weight of the object prior to raising it. If it's as well heavy, request for aid or usage tools like a dolly or cart to carry it safely.

Remember to take breaks throughout lifting jobs to offer your back muscle mass a possibility to relax and protect against overexertion. By applying proper lifting methods, you can avoid pain in the back and reduce the threat of injuries, guaranteeing your back remains healthy and balanced and strong for the long-term.

Lack of Regular Exercise and Extending



A less active way of life devoid of routine workout and stretching can considerably add to neck and back pain and discomfort. When you do not participate in physical activity, your muscle mass end up being weak and stringent, causing inadequate stance and boosted strain on your back. Routine exercise aids reinforce the muscular tissues that support your back, improving security and minimizing the threat of pain in the back. Incorporating extending into your routine can additionally boost flexibility, protecting against tightness and pain in your back muscle mass.

To prevent back pain triggered by a lack of workout and stretching, go for at the very least 30 minutes of moderate exercise most days of the week. Consist of workouts that target your core muscular tissues, as a strong core can assist alleviate pressure on your back.


Additionally, take breaks to stretch and move throughout the day, particularly if you have a desk work. Basic stretches like touching your toes or doing shoulder rolls can assist soothe stress and avoid pain in the back. Focusing on normal exercise and stretching can go a long way in keeping a healthy and balanced back and minimizing discomfort.
